When was Mood Indigo released?


Mood Indigo is first released in 1957 as part of Cleo Laine's album "The April Age/she's the Tops" which includes 25 tracks in total. This song is the 6th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Mood Indigo?


Mood Indigo falls under the genre Jazz.
✔️

How long is the song Mood Indigo?


Mood Indigo song length is 3 minutes and 10 seconds.
